Strong's H844 (Hebrew)
Hebrew: אַשְׂרִיאֵל (ʼAsrîyʼêl)
Pronunciation: as-ree-ale'
Morphology: n-pr-m
Name Meaning: Ashriel or Asriel = "I shall be prince of God"
Derivation: an orthographical variation for אֲשַׂרְאֵל (ʼĂsarʼêl) H840
Definition: Asriel, the name of two Israelites
KJV Renderings: Ashriel, Asriel
Senses
- a great-grandson of Manasseh, and son of Gilead
- a son of Manasseh
